What does a fleet engineering manager do?

A Fleet Engineering Manager oversees the maintenance, operation, and optimization of a company's fleet of vehicles or vessels. They are responsible for ensuring that all fleet assets are safe, efficient, and compliant with regulations. This role involves managing maintenance schedules, coordinating with vendors, implementing cost-saving strategies, and leading engineering teams. Fleet Engineering Managers also analyze fleet performance data to improve reliability and support the organization's operational goals.

What is the difference between Fleet Engineering Manager vs Fleet Maintenance Supervisor?

AspectFleet Engineering ManagerFleet Maintenance Supervisor
ResponsibilitiesOversees fleet design, engineering projects, and technical strategiesManages daily maintenance, repairs, and service schedules
CredentialsBachelor's in engineering or related field, technical certificationsTechnical training, certifications in vehicle repair and maintenance
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with site visits, engineering teamsGarage or maintenance facility, hands-on supervision
Industry UsageUsed in logistics, transportation, and fleet management companiesCommon in fleet service centers and maintenance depots

The Fleet Engineering Manager focuses on technical design and engineering strategies for fleet optimization, while the Fleet Maintenance Supervisor handles daily maintenance operations and repairs. Both roles require relevant technical credentials and are essential in fleet management but differ in scope and responsibilities.

GATEWAY FLEET SPECIALIST:
Starlink is building the world's largest fleet of satellite ground stations. These gateways are the critical link between our satellites and the global internet backbone, and their reliability directly determines the quality of service for millions of users. We are seeking fleet specialists to own the reliability, growth, and sustainment of our fleet of Gateway antennas and sites across a region of the world. This is a true owner-operator role, managing everything from technical troubleshooting and spare parts strategy to international logistics, contractor performance, and field execution. This role is ideal for someone who excels at building operational excellence in fast-moving and internationally complex environments. You must be equally comfortable managing heavy equipment deployments in remote locations as you are negotiating with customs authorities and coaching contractors toward higher performance standards.
R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Own the maintenance, operations, health, and growth for our fleet of Starlink Gateway Antennas and Sites for a region of the world
  • Manage spare parts strategy, inventory planning, and materials movement across the region, to maintain rapid response readiness for both planned and emergency maintenance
  • Monitor fleet health using dashboards and telemetry data to identify issues, diagnose software and hardware failures, drive timely repairs, and identify emerging degradation trends.
  • Partner with engineering teams to execute fleetwide campaigns and perform root cause analysis on antenna and site failures across electrical, fiber optic, radiofrequency, and mechanical systems
  • Coordinate with logistics providers, customs authorities, and regional partners to ensure timely and compliant international shipping of critical parts and equipment
  • Manage relationships with contracted labor in the region, including training and capability development
  • Analyze operational data and field feedback to identify systemic pain points and drive improvements in processes and tools
  • Share ownership of the team's growth: work with engineers and specialists to build scalable organizational structures that can support the rapid expansion of the world's largest fleet of satellite ground stations.
